In a surprising turn of events, the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) announced Suryakumar Yadav as the new captain of the Indian T20I team for the upcoming series against Sri Lanka. The announcement, made on 18 July, has raised eyebrows as Hardik Pandya, who was widely expected to take over from Rohit Sharma, was overlooked for the role. Instead, Suryakumar Yadav, who has shown exceptional leadership in his brief tenure, will lead the team.
Suryakumar Yadav’s appointment comes after he led the team in seven matches, winning five of them. During these matches, Yadav scored 300 runs, including two fifties and a century. His performance under pressure and ability to inspire his teammates have been key factors in his promotion to captaincy.
The decision to appoint Suryakumar over Hardik Pandya has generated significant discussion among cricket enthusiasts. Hardik, who captained the Indian T20I side throughout the 2023 season, was expected to be the natural successor to Rohit Sharma. However, the selectors opted for Yadav, possibly due to his impressive track record in limited opportunities.
In another interesting move, Shubman Gill was named the vice-captain of the T20I side. Gill’s consistent performance and potential as a future leader may have influenced this decision. Meanwhile, Riyan Parag retained his place in the squad, while Abhishek Sharma, who scored a hundred against Zimbabwe in a recent series, was not included. Sanju Samson and Rishabh Pant were chosen as the wicketkeepers, with KL Rahul still absent from the T20I setup.
India’s T20I Squad vs Sri Lanka:
- Suryakumar Yadav (C)
- Shubman Gill (VC)
- Yashasvi Jaiswal
- Rinku Singh
- Riyan Parag
- Rishabh Pant (WK)
- Sanju Samson (WK)
- Hardik Pandya
- Shivam Dube
- Axar Patel
- Washington Sundar
- Ravi Bishnoi
- Arshdeep Singh
- Khaleel Ahmed
- Mohd. Siraj
The series against Sri Lanka includes three T20Is and three ODIs. The T20I matches will be held in Pallekele, starting on July 27 and concluding on July 30. The ODI series will commence in Colombo on August 2.
